1. What is Radial Distance from Central Axis?

Radial distance from central axis is defined as the distance between the whisker sensor's pivot point to the whisker-object contact point in rotational systems. It represents how far an object is from the center of rotation.

2. How Does the Calculator Work?

The calculator uses the formula:

\[ dr = \frac{ac}{\omega^2} \]

Where:

Explanation: This formula calculates the radial distance based on the centripetal acceleration and angular velocity of a rotating object.

3. Importance of Radial Distance Calculation

Details: Calculating radial distance is crucial for understanding rotational dynamics, designing mechanical systems with rotating components, and analyzing circular motion in physics and engineering applications.

5. Frequently Asked Questions (FAQ)

Q1: What is centripetal acceleration?
A: Centripetal acceleration is the property of the motion of a body traversing a circular path, directed toward the center of rotation.

Q2: How is angular velocity measured?
A: Angular velocity is measured in radians per second (rad/s) and indicates how fast an object rotates or revolves relative to another point.

Q3: What are typical applications of this calculation?
A: This calculation is used in robotics (whisker sensors), mechanical engineering (rotating machinery), physics experiments, and any system involving circular motion.

Q4: Can this formula be used for any rotating object?
A: Yes, this formula applies to any object in uniform circular motion where centripetal acceleration and angular velocity are known.

Q5: What units should be used for accurate results?
A: For consistent results, use meters per second squared (m/s²) for centripetal acceleration and radians per second (rad/s) for angular velocity.
